Study Tip of the Week
Music Scholarship
Tip: Find diverse composers!
The Harvard Library offers a variety of services that allow you to discover musicians and
composers from traditionally marginalized and underrepresented backgrounds:
The Composer Diversity Database

lists the websites of various composers and focuses on women and composers of color.
Searches can be limited by genre, demographic group, and location.
RILM Music Encyclopedias

is an international and multilingual collection of current and historical music
encyclopedias published from 1775 to the present. The collection covers popular music and
musical theatre, opera, instruments, blues, gospel, recorded sound, and women composers.

Composing music at Harvard
In addition to academic resources related to musical scores and recordings, the Harvard
Library also offers tools for you to create music!
* Finale or Sibelius: in the Listening Room and in Lamont Media.
* Audio or video editing software: on computers in the SLab/Listening Room and Lamont
Media,
* Recording equipment: Can be borrowed from the Lamont Media Lab and Cabot's
Technology Lending Program.

Treading the Borders: Immigration and the American Stage
Special Exhibition Tour and Film Screening
Monday, December 10
Exhibition Tour, 6:00-6:45 PM:
Much of the richness and vitality of the performing arts in the United States derives from
creative talent originating elsewhere. This exhibition explores how successive waves of
immigration transformed the American stage, highlighting the virtuosity and resilience of
a diverse group of actors, artists, and entertainers from the colonial era to the present
day.
Film Screening, 7:00 PM, Harvard Film Archive: Street Scene (1931)
Based on the Pulitzer Prize-winning play by Elmer Rice, Street Scene chronicles 24 hours
in a multicultural Hell's Kitchen tenement and the tragic consequences of a secret
affair.
